Where and when was Malia Obama born?

Malia Obama Life in and Out of the White House Michelle Sasha Obama
Source: MEGA

Like America itself, Malia Ann Obama was born on July 4. In 1998, Barack and Michelle Obama welcomed their first child at the University of Illinois Chicago Medical Center and their lives were forever altered in the most blissful of ways.

What’s in a name?

Malia was named that moniker for many reasons.
Source: MEGA

Malia Obama was given her name from her father’s desire to pay tribute to his Hawaiian and African past (the father of Barack Obama was from the continent). Malia translates to “queen” in Swahili. In Hawaiian, the name Malia means “calm or gentle waters.”

Where did that dog Bo come from, anyway?

Malia Obama Life in and Out of the White House Bo
Source: MEGA

Malia suffered from allergies that stemmed from animal dander. Therefore, the First Family had to be extremely careful in finding a pet. They promised their kids if, and when, they won the 2008 election that the Obama family could finally have a dog. It was something the youngest Obamas had clamored for since they could talk. The family narrowed it down to two breeds—a labradoodle and the Portuguese water dog. The latter won out and it arrived in the form of a six-month-old puppy from a political icon—Senator Ted Kennedy. The young pup was given the moniker of Bo. After all, Bo Knows!

Did Barack and Michelle attend Malia’s parent-teacher conferences?

Malia Obama said it was OK if her dad, President Obama, did not attend parent-teacher conferences.
Source: MEGA

Malia let it be known that her president father was not necessarily her favorite choice to attend parent-teacher conferences. Michelle spoke to that in a recent speech. She stated, “Barack went to a parent-teacher conference and, you know, he’s got a big motorcade. It’s big. And men with guns—machine guns—and black sniper gear. They follow him everywhere in trucks and they’re leaning out, looking at you like, ‘I will kill you,’ because that’s their job. Malia was like, ‘Dad, come on.’ So, everybody was OK when dad didn’t go! Sort of politely going, ‘Dad, you don’t have to come to the Fall-Winter concert. It’s OK. You can take a pass.’” Still Barack made several parent-teacher conferences, sporting events and, yes, concerts.

What was Malia’s most impactful trip—history-wise?

Malia Obama Life in and Out of the White House Hugging Michelle
Source: MEGA

Being part of the first First Family to visit Cuba since the Communist regime took over so many decades ago was another traveling highlight for Malia. She, Sasha and Michelle had a moment that each will treasure forever. They dedicated two magnolia trees and a bench at the U.S. Embassy in Old Havana. They also got to meet the young children whose parents tirelessly work for the American people at the embassy in the Caribbean nation.

What was Jenna and Barbara Bush’s advice for Malia post-White House?

Malia Obama Life in and Out of the White House Bush Twins
Source: MEGA

If anyone should know what it is like to be a former child resident of the White House, it is Barbara and Jenna Bush. The two penned a letter to the girls when they arrived at 1600 Pennsylvania. They also wrote another for their journey outside the fish bowl that is the president’s house. The highlight had to be when the two stated, “Enjoy college. As most of the world knows, we did. And you won’t have the weight of the world on your young shoulders anymore. Explore your passions. Learn who you are. Make mistakes—you are allowed to. Continue to surround yourself with loyal friends who know you, adore you and will fiercely protect you. Those who judge you don’t love you, and their voices shouldn’t hold weight. Rather, it’s your own hearts that matter.”
